Got it. FN is one of the few that actually fit me. Wide enough shoulders, long enough arms, wide enough chest, and no curtains for me. ANd FN are pricey enough. I can't get on board with the law of diminishing returns as applied to IH. i'm convinced that FN's shirts are made for tall, lanky fellas. At 5'11 their Lancaster shirt was definitely blousey and of the dick curtain variety. But mine didn't have gussets which might explain things. either way the cut/fit didn't work for me. If you were still able to get IH through Rakuten their prices are about what you would pay for FN, but now that Rakuten can no longer sell IH you'd have to pay $300+ for one of their flannels. I know that price is hard to swallow but i'm a firm believer now that IH has the best quality out there. I can't quite afford IH flannels at the moment but if and when I get some spare cash lying around i'm gonna spring for another flannel shirt. It's one of the few brands where I can safely look at their fit charts and know that i'm getting what I paid for. Your right, I could use a little more room in the gut. I'm 6'4" and not skinny. I did miss the boat on Rakuten, but do remain sorely tempted to buy that new Western IH put out.
